The state requires bacteriological sample results be kept
_____ years.
5 years
The state requires chemical analysis be kept at least _____
years.
10 years
EPA requires a water system to keep a copy of each
consumer confidence report at least _____
years.
5 years
A public water system provides the public with piped water
for human consumption, serves
at least _____ service connections, and regularly serves at
least _____ individuals daily at least _____
days out of the year.
15 service connections
25 individuals
60 days out of the year

In Texas, water operator licensing is administered by the
_____.
TCEQ
All public water systems are required to employ licensed
operators even if the system only
_____ treated water bought from another source.
redistributes treated water
Public water systems include cities, municipal utility
districts, rural water supply
corporations, mobile home parks, and _____.
campgrounds
Examples of community water systems include ________.
a. municipalities
b. municipal utility districts
c. rural water supply corporations
d. mobile home parks
e. all the above
e. all of the above
A federal agency impacting the water utility industry is the
_____.
EPA
The most important federal law impacting the water utility
industry is the _____.
Safe Drinking Water Act (PL93-523)
The four national safety and quality standards for drinking
water covered in the Safe
Drinking Water Act are physical, chemical, ________ and
radiological.
bacteriological

,3



The state agency that regulates drinking water in Texas and
administers the federal Safe
Drinking Water Act is the ________.
TCEQ
Water utility system personnel are required to notify the
TCEQ of changes or alterations of
the system, a new facility to be built, and water supply
________.
health hazards
Some regional and local agencies impacting the water utility
industry are municipal utility
districts, rural water supply corporations, drainage districts,
________, groundwater
conservation districts, and subsidence districts.
river authorities
